I love John Williams (who composed the Harry Potter music), and I think his music for the film was spot on! I think my favourite John Williams score is probably Schindler's List though.

One thing my friends and I discovered fairly early on was that you can fit the main theme from Elgar's Cello Concerto (1st movement) to the main theme of Harry Potter (the bit where they're going across the lake in the boats and you see Hogwarts for the first time in the first one), and it fits perfectly. Perhaps Williams was making a statement about Englishness, lol? I was in a performance of the Elgar at the time, so we did try it out!!
